HMD debuts its first original Pulse series phones with ‘Gen 1’ repairability

What you need to know

  • HMD has debuted its first original lineup of phones under the “Pulse” series.
  • The trio features the same Unisoc T606 CPU and Android 14. However, the Pulse Pro offers a set of 50MP cameras and a 5,000mAh battery with 20W fast charging.
  • HMD launches its Pulse series in international markets, though the company plans to bring the “HMD Vibe” to the U.S. market.

HMD Global announces the launch of its “first original” trio of devices dubbed the Pulse series.

According to a press release, HMD states the new Pulse series is the beginning of its commitment to bring self-repairable devices to consumers. Under the “Gen 1 repairability” title, the company adds its partnership with iFixit should help users quickly find the parts they need if anything goes wrong.

(Image credit: hm)

The HMD Pulse Pro leads the trio with a 6.6-inch HD+ display. The back of the phone contains a vertical dual camera array featuring a 50 MP AF Dual camera and a 2MP depth sensor. HMD states consumers will find a Super Night and Tripod mode alongside Flash Shot and AI HDR.
